Transaction 5177afc0db7d7dfd7078b15a24909f4069decc844f9528ebc907aa7c6b8f480d

1 Input
2 Outputs
  • 5177afc0db7d7dfd7078b15a24909f4069decc844f9528ebc907aa7c6b8f480d:0
  • value  21354685
    address  3MToHT8PVBUKQoMq7eKxg7aoevvRyd7Sjc
  • 5177afc0db7d7dfd7078b15a24909f4069decc844f9528ebc907aa7c6b8f480d:1
  • value  8290000
    address  3PpYm4Fo4dhJj6wgA1aGGrEPcjcXbkpWPX